Car drives into crowd in Germany
One person was killed and several were injured when a car drove into a crowd of people in the western German city of Mannheim, a police spokesperson said on Monday. The car's driver has been detained, but it is unclear whether there are other suspects, the spokesperson added. Police are appealing to the public to avoid the area. The incident occurred as crowds gathered in cities across western Germany's Rhineland for parades to mark the carnival season.

Economic impact of minerals deal called off
On Friday, President Donald Trump berated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y for being ?disrespectful? in an extraordinary Oval Office meeting. Immediately following, President Trump called off the signing of a minerals deal that he said would have moved Ukraine closer to ending its war with Russia. It?s unclear what the blowup could mean for the deal that Trump insisted was essential to repay the U.S. for the more than $180 billion in American aid sent to Kyiv since the start of the war. Hamas rejects Israel's ceasefire proposal
On Saturday, Hamas said it rejected Israel's ceasefire extension proposal for the first phase. This came on the day the first stage of the ceasefire was set to expire. The latest round of talks on the second phase of the ceasefire between Israel and Hamas has made no progress so far, and it was unclear whether the talks would resume on Saturday, a senior Hamas official said. Vatican: Pope Francis had a bronchial spasm
Pope Francis suffered a bronchial spasm on Friday that resulted in him breathing in vomit, requiring non-invasive mechanical ventilation, the Vatican said in relaying a setback in his two-week long battle against double pneumonia. The 88-year-old pope responded well, with a good level of gas exchange, and remained conscious and alert at all times, the Vatican said in its late update. The development marked a setback in what had been two successive days of increasingly upbeat reports from doctors treating Francis at Rome?s Gemelli hospital since Feb. 14.
